Probably the worst time in a person's life is when they have to kill a family member because they are the devil. But otherwise it's been a pretty good day.

- Emo Philips

Emo Philips is an American comedian, writer, and actor known for his surreal and often dark sense of humor. He has been a prominent figure in the comedy world for over three decades, with a career spanning stand-up comedy, writing, and acting.
